Chess cancelled for the remainder of 2020

Sadly, the Committee has taken the decision to cancel chess for the remainder of 2020, on the basis that there is no reasonable prospect of being able to recommence the activities in the current year. The stage 4 restrictions are in place until mid-September, and the venue is waiting until 100 people can meet before it re-opens, as such even fitting in a club championship over 7 weeks is not possible.
When we are able to meet again, we will do so with our AGM to direct what the club does in 2021.
The club will not be charging any membership fees for 2020. Therefore, players who have paid their 2020 membership will have this credited to the following year. If any player would prefer a refund of the membership, please feel free to contact me with bank details and I’ll arrange the deposit.
Players are welcome to play casual games against each other, I have played a number of members in multiple games and have enjoyed playing, despite it being done remotely.
